본 발명은 보강용 무기 충전재로서의 침강 실리카 및 엘라스토머를 포함한 엘라스토머 조성물의 제조에서의 폴리카복실산의 용도에 관한 것으로, 상기 폴리카복실산 및 상기 침강 실리카는 엘라스토머에 서로 독립적으로 혼입된다. 본 발명은 또한 엘라스토머 조성물, 및 이러한 엘라스토머 조성물의 제조 방법에 관한 것이다.
